#160389 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#160389 is composed of 8.6% red, 1.2%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.9% cyan, 97.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 248.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 27.5%. #160389 color hex could be obtained by blending #2c06ff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#160389 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#160389 has RGB values of R:22, G:3,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 1442697.

Shades and Tints of #160389
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000003 is the darkest color, while #f1ee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#160389
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444448 is the less saturated color, while #160389 is the most saturated one.
